Herzlesstein
Herzlesstein is a peak in Rettenberg, Oberallgäu, Bavaria and has an elevation of 1,455 metres. Herzlesstein is situated nearby to the locality Im Weiher, as well as near Hühner Moos.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Herzlesstein
- Type: Peak with an elevation of 1,455 metres
- Description: ridge prominence of Grünten in the Allgäu Alps in Bavaria, Germany
- Categories: ridge prominence and landform
- Location: Rettenberg, Oberallgäu, Bavarian Swabia, Bavaria, Germany, Central Europe, Europe
